Insurance
Exhibitor Liability Insurance is required for all Exhibitors. You have the option to submit an Additional Insurance Certificate from your insurance provider or purchase coverage through Rainprotection Insurance Company. Refer to your contract on page 2, paragraph 21 for the exact language required for the Additional Insured Certificate.
Rainprotection Insurance policy is $84 for $1,000,000 single occurrence and $2,000,000 aggregate coverage. The coverage will include move-in, Show days, and move-out. This will meet all of the insurance requirements for the Show and our venue. You will not need to supply any additional certificates. Health Permit for Food Vendors
If you will be selling or offering samples of food or beverage to the public, you must submit the Sacramento County Health Department - Food Vendor Application. You are required to obtain this permit whether you sample or not. Regardless of other licenses or permits you or your co-packer might have. The Show is required to obtain a copy of all Food Vendor Applications and them as a group to the Health Department. To meet their deadline you must submit your completed application no later than July 22nd. Reseller’s Permit
The State of California requires that you have a seller’s permit if you will be selling merchandise, booking orders, or taking leads at this show.
